Understanding the French Driving License
In France, driving licenses are categorized into different groups based on the type of lorry. The most typical types include:
License TypeLorry TypeMinimum AgeBCars (approximately 3.5 heaps) and light trailers18A1Motorbikes (as much as 125cc)16AAll bikes24CTrucks21DBuses24
It's crucial for candidates to ensure they are obtaining the correct category based on their driving needs.
Actions to Obtain a French Driving License Online
In this digital age, the procedure of obtaining a French driving license can be performed online, making it more available. Here's a detailed guide:
Step 1: Determine Eligibility
Before starting the application, it's crucial to guarantee eligibility. Aspects include:

To use online, candidates need to sign up an account on the official French permit application portal, ANTS (Agence Nationale des Titres Sécurisés).
Steps to sign up consist of:

The following files are generally needed for the application:
DocumentDescriptionIdentification documentPassport or national ID cardProof of residencyUtility bill or lease contractPhotosCurrent passport-sized photosMedical certificate(if appropriate) showing fitness to drivePrevious driving license(if applicable) if transforming to a French license
Being organized and having these files ready will improve the application process.

After submitting the application, there's a fee involved, typically varying based on the license type. Payment can generally be made through the ANTS portal utilizing credit cards or other accepted payment techniques.
Action 6: Wait for Processing
After submission, candidates will receive an acknowledgment of their application. The processing time can vary between a couple of weeks to several months, depending on individual scenarios and the work of the processing authority.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Can I obtain a French driving license online if I have a foreign driving license?
A1: Yes, you may be qualified to exchange your foreign license for a French one online. Nevertheless, specific contracts in between France and your home country might use.
Q2: What if my driving license is ended?
A2: If your license has expired, you must renew it before trying to request a French driving license.
Q3: Is there a written test for the French driving license?
A3: Yes, prospects may be required to pass a theoretical test depending upon their circumstances, particularly if they are obtaining their first license.
Q4: How long is the French driving license valid for?
A4: Typically, a French driving license is valid for 15 years for category B. After this duration, it should be renewed.
Q5: What to do if my application is declined?
A5: In case of rejection, candidates can appeal the choice or reapply by addressing the reasons for preliminary denial.
